Why Your Hyperlocal Service Pages Fail to Rank in the Next Zip Code
In my 12 years of experience specializing in Google Business Profile (GBP) optimization and local search strategy, I have seen thousands of business owners face the same maddening “Proximity Trap.” You’ve done everything right: your office is verified, your profile is complete, and you rank #1 for your primary keywords when you’re sitting at your desk. But the moment you drive two miles down the road into the next zip code, your business pin disappears. This failure in hyperlocal seo is the single biggest barrier to scaling a service-area business (SAB).
The frustration is real. You are licensed to work in the entire county, yet Google treats you like a ghost once you cross a neighborhood boundary. To break this barrier, you must understand that Google’s local algorithm isn’t just looking for a business that *can* serve an area; it is looking for the most relevant, prominent, and proximate solution. Most businesses fail because they ignore the technical and content-based signals required to project “relevance” where they lack “proximity.” In this guide, I will show you how to leverage google business profile seo to expand your reach far beyond your physical front door.
The Three Pillars of the Local Map Pack: Proximity, Relevance, and Prominence
To understand why you aren’t ranking in the next zip code, we have to look at the three foundational pillars Google uses to determine the local map pack seo. These are Proximity, Relevance, and Prominence. While Google rarely shares the exact weight of these factors, research and testing have shown that Proximity is often the heaviest – and most frustrating – signal.
Proximity is simply how close your business is to the searcher. If someone searches for “plumber” while standing three blocks from your office, you have a massive advantage. However, as the distance increases, your “proximity score” drops. This is The Real Reason Your Business Pin Only Shows Up for People Standing in the Parking Lot. When proximity fades, you must compensate by over-delivering on Relevance and Prominence.
Relevance refers to how well your business profile and website match what the user is looking for. If you want to rank google business profile listings in a neighboring town, your digital footprint must scream that you are an expert in *that specific town*. Prominence, on the other hand, is about your offline and online authority. This includes your review count, star rating, and local citations. To “break” the proximity barrier, your relevance and prominence must be so high that Google feels compelled to show you even if there is a closer (but less authoritative) competitor. Using professional local seo software can help you visualize these gaps compared to your competitors.
The “Service Area” Fallacy: Why Your Zip Code List Isn’t Working
One of the most common mistakes I see in service area business seo is the “Zip Code Dump.” Business owners often believe that by simply listing 50 zip codes in the “Service Areas” section of their Google Business Profile, they will magically appear in all of them. This is a fallacy. Google views that list as a suggestion, not a command.
In fact, research indicates that if your verified address is outside the target service area, you face a natural uphill battle. Google’s primary goal is to provide the most trustworthy result. If you say you serve a zip code 15 miles away but have zero “proof of work” in that area, Google’s algorithm will prioritize a local competitor. A mere list of numbers on a page provides no contextual relevance. Google needs to see that you are actually active in those areas.
To effectively rank higher on google maps in adjacent territories, you need to move away from listing zip codes and start building “Geographic Relevance.” This means your website and GBP must reflect real-world activity. If you are a roofer, don’t just say you serve Zip Code 90210. You need to show the algorithm that you were physically in 90210 last Tuesday. Without this proof, your service area list is just thin content that the algorithm will likely ignore.
Technical Gaps: Schema Markup and Map Embeds
When we look at the technical side of hyperlocal seo, the gaps are often found in how your website communicates with Google’s crawlers. Many businesses use static map embeds or generic contact pages that do nothing to prove their service area. To fix this, you must implement advanced Schema markup.
Generic `LocalBusiness` schema is no longer enough. You need to utilize specific `ServiceArea` and `geo-coordinates` fields within your JSON-LD. This is The Specific Schema Fields We Used to Prove Our Physical Location to Google and our extended reach. By defining your `hasMap` and `areaServed` properties with precision, you provide a machine-readable roadmap for Google to follow. If you are unsure if your current technical setup is working, I recommend using a google business profile audit tool to identify missing data fields that could be throttling your visibility.
Additionally, avoid the mistake of embedding the same map on every “city page.” Each hyperlocal page should feature a map that is specific to that area, perhaps highlighting local landmarks or specific neighborhoods. This signals to Google that the page isn’t just a template – it’s a resource designed for a specific geographic community. Professionals often use google business profile seo strategies that involve dynamic map integrations to ensure each page sends a unique geo-signal.
The “Proof of Work” Strategy: Bridging the Proximity Gap
If you want to rank google business profile assets in a zip code where you don’t have an office, you must provide “Proof of Work.” This is the most effective way to overcome the proximity signal. Google tracks user behavior and data from mobile devices to verify if a business is actually where it says it is.
First, use “Proof-of-Work” photos. When your team is out on a job in a target zip code, take high-quality photos. While Google has become more sophisticated regarding EXIF data (geotags), the visual content and the location of the upload still matter. Uploading these photos directly to your GBP while at the job site creates a powerful “check-in” signal. To manage this at scale, many businesses utilize local seo automation tools to schedule and categorize these updates.
Second, focus on neighborhood-specific reviews. A review that says “Great service!” is good. A review that says “Sandeep did a great job fixing our HVAC in the Northwood neighborhood of Irvine” is gold. When a customer mentions a specific neighborhood or zip code in their review – and you mention it again in your response – you are building massive geo targeted seo relevance. These interaction signals, combined with “Direction Requests” from users in that specific area, tell Google that you are a highly relevant choice for that community, regardless of where your office is located.
Lastly, don’t overlook the power of local engagement. If you can get people in the target zip code to search for your brand specifically, your proximity barrier will begin to crumble. This is why google maps ranking signals are so heavily influenced by brand strength and local user interaction.
Content Strategy: Writing for Neighborhoods, Not Just Cities
The era of the generic “City Page” is over. If you want to dominate hyperlocal seo, you have to go deeper. Most businesses create one page for “Los Angeles” and wonder why they don’t rank in “Santa Monica” or “Silver Lake.” The key is to How to Fix the Hidden Content Gaps Killing Your Local Map Rankings by creating content for neighborhoods.
Each city page seo strategy should include unique local data. This includes:
- Local Landmarks: Mentioning your proximity to a local park or stadium.
- Specific Local Problems: For example, “Dealing with the hard water issues common in [Neighborhood Name].”
- Local Client Stories: Case studies of work performed specifically in that neighborhood.
This level of detail prevents “thin content” penalties and proves to Google that your business is an integral part of that specific community. When your content is this granular, your local map pack seo performance will naturally improve because you are answering the highly specific queries that local residents are actually searching for. To track how these changes affect your reach, I suggest using a google maps rank tracker to monitor your position in each specific neighborhood over time.
Case Study: From Invisible to Dominant
In one notable instance, an auto repair shop struggled to attract customers from a wealthy suburb just five miles away. By shifting their strategy from generic city-wide keywords to a localized approach – utilizing neighborhood-specific reviews and geotagged project galleries – they saw a massive shift. According to research, this shop turned a $24k investment in local SEO into $2.8M in revenue. They didn’t move their office; they simply used local seo software to identify and fill the relevance gaps that were keeping them out of the map pack in that lucrative neighboring zip code.
Conclusion & Actionable Checklist
Scaling your reach in the hyperlocal seo landscape is not about tricking the algorithm; it is about providing the data Google needs to trust you in a new area. Proximity will always be a factor, but it can be overcome by overwhelming relevance and prominence. By focusing on technical schema, proof-of-work content, and neighborhood-level granularity, you can The Proximity Fix that Helps You Show up Further from Your Office.
Your Actionable Checklist:
- Audit your GBP using a google business profile audit tool.
- Implement `ServiceArea` schema with precise geo-coordinates.
- Upload “Proof of Work” photos from your target zip codes weekly.
- Encourage customers to mention their neighborhood in reviews.
- Create dedicated pages for specific neighborhoods, not just major cities.
If you are ready to expand your footprint, consider hiring a professional google maps ranking service to execute this roadmap and dominate the map pack.

